Ecclestone downplays potential legal issues of delaying Halo
Bernie Ecclestone has downplayed suggestions that, following the decision to postpone the introduction of the Halo, an accident involving head injuries in 2017 could lead to legal issues. Ecclestone is fully behind the postponement, and is keen to point out that the Halo may yet be replaced by an alternative system. Meanwhile, the Halo is set to be tried on track by more drivers from Spa until the end of the season. “We’re going to have a look at it,” Ecclestone told Motorsport.com. “We’re not calling it the Halo, we’re just looking at it as frontal protection for drivers.
